Inscription.
In memorium
to
Cecil B. Strange
An outstanding citizen who served his community with earnest endeavor and diligent work for community beautification, industrial reclamation and national conservation. Respected and loved by his fellow men as a friend, neighbor, and loyal American.
 
Location. 27° 53.685′ N, 81° 58.392′ W. Marker is in Mulberry, Florida, in Polk County. Marker is on West Canal Street (Florida Route 60), on the right when traveling east. Click for map. Marker is between Mulberry City Hall and the street. It is difficult to spot because it is nearly ground-level. Marker is in this post office area: Mulberry FL 33860, United States of America.

Cecil Brice Strange, 1903-1966.
 
Additional comments.
1. Cecil B. Strange Family
Cecil B. Strange is my uncle. I grew up in Mulberry, Florida and fondly remember him. He built his children a fish pond which is still there. The house is long gone. That area of Mulberry was all “company” housing owned by IMCC phosphate mining. This is the company that employed Uncle Cecil for all the grounds upkeep of their offices plus the local swimming pool.
